Levítico 9:4 Comentario: Rashi, Rashbam, Sforno & Rabbeinu Bahya

וְשׁ֨וֹר וָאַ֜יִל לִשְׁלָמִ֗ים לִזְבֹּ֙חַ֙ לִפְנֵ֣י יְהוָ֔ה וּמִנְחָ֖ה בְּלוּלָ֣ה בַשָּׁ֑מֶן כִּ֣י הַיּ֔וֹם יְהוָ֖ה נִרְאָ֥ה אֲלֵיכֶֽם׃

Asimismo un buey y un carnero para sacrificio de paces, que inmoléis delante de SEÑOR; y un presente amasado con aceite:  porque SEÑOR se aparecerá hoy á vosotros.

Rashi on Leviticus

כי היום ה' נראה אליכם FOR TODAY THE LORD WILL APPEAR UNTO YOU to make His Shechinah rest upon your handiwork; on this account these sacrifices come (are to be brought) as an obligation for this day (cf. Sifra, Shemini, Mechilta d'Miluim 2 4).

Rashbam on Leviticus

כי היום ה' נראה, and the fire will emerge from heaven to consume the sacrifices on the altar.

Sforno on Leviticus

כי היום ה' נראה אליכם, it had already become manifest as an appreciation of their handiwork when we read that the Presence (glory) of the Lord filled the Tabernacle (Exodus 40,34). It is therefore no more than appropriate that you express your appreciation of this by this sacrifice.
